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ities:

As the Program Director, you will be responsible for:

* Recruiting, orienting, and supervising faculty members for the department.
* Conducting regular observations and evaluations of faculty to ensure excellence in teaching.
* Supporting faculty in their professional development.
* Assuring correct scheduling and registration of returning students.
* Participating in the budgeting process to meet program needs.
* Reviewing student progress and eligibility for graduation.
* Collaborating on curriculum development and updates.
* Organizing advisory committee meetings.
* Participating in accreditation self-studies.
* Maintaining department equipment and coordination with externship placements.
* Advising students on their academic journey.
* Other duties as assigned by the Academic Dean.

Qualifications

Qualifications:


To be successful in this role, you should have:

* Certification: Certified Surgical Technologist (CST) certification is required.

* Education: Associate degree in Surgical Technology.

* Experience:
o Minimum 5 years experience in scrub role; AND
o Minimum of 3 years in the last 5 years as a practicing surgical technologist OR instructor in surgical technology.

* Teaching: Previous teaching experience is preferred.

* Management: Management experience is required.

* Communication Skills: Excellent oral and written communication skills required.
